Output e37d7afbe61a7ed095a444a1e57e23821839dfc94e5d292676c3c9a4f92c5686:1

value
59323
script pubkey
OP_0 OP_PUSHBYTES_20 edddb40f82174656561bd320815d52a9eb9c169f
address
bc1qahwmgruzzar9v4sm6vsgzh2j484ec95lgr7xjw
transaction
e37d7afbe61a7ed095a444a1e57e23821839dfc94e5d292676c3c9a4f92c5686
confirmations
211097
spent
true